How do Enosburg Falls pet spas handle pets that are anxious about the grooming process, especially those not used to the sounds of a rural working farm environment?

Many local groomers are accustomed to pets from quieter, rural settings. They typically use slow introduction techniques, positive reinforcement with treats, and calming aids like pheromone sprays. Some may even schedule appointments during quieter hours to minimize stress from other animals or nearby farm equipment, ensuring a gentle and patient experience for your pet.

Beyond the Brush: Why Spa Dog Grooming is the Ultimate Vermont Treat for Your Pup

Here in Enosburg Falls, we know a thing or two about embracing the seasons. From summer hikes along the Missisquoi River to wintery walks through our snowy fields, our adventurous dogs are right by our side. But all that local fun can leave our furry friends with more than just happy memories. Muddy paws, burrs in their coat, and dry skin from the elements are common complaints. That’s where modern spa dog grooming steps in—it’s not just a haircut; it’s a wellness ritual designed for the active Vermont dog.

Think of it as a reset button for your pup. A true spa grooming session goes far beyond a basic bath. It starts with a gentle, breed-specific shampoo, often oatmeal-based to soothe the itchy skin that our dry winters can cause. Then comes a thorough conditioning treatment to replenish moisture lost from romping through our fields. The meticulous brushing that follows isn't just for looks; it’s a chance to check for the ticks that are prevalent in our area, remove any hidden mats, and promote healthy skin circulation.

For our local pups, the practical benefits are immense. A professional deshedding treatment in the spring can turn your home from a fur-filled zone back into a cozy haven. A precise paw pad trim and nail grind provides better traction on our icy sidewalks and protects those sensitive pads from road salt. And a calming blueberry facial or a paw balm application isn't just indulgence—it’s targeted care for the parts of your dog that interact most with our rugged environment.
